The cart-based conventional breast ultrasound systems market is a segment within the broader medical imaging field, focusing on portable diagnostic equipment designed to offer high-resolution imaging for breast cancer detection and monitoring. These systems are integral to the healthcare value chain, providing critical support to radiologists and oncologists in hospitals and specialized clinics. They serve applications such as routine screenings, diagnostic assessments, and guiding biopsy procedures. With technological advancements, these systems have seen innovations in image quality and processing speed, aligning with the growing demand for early and accurate diagnosis. The market is influenced by the increasing prevalence of breast cancer and heightened awareness around women's health, driving adoption across regions.

However, the market faces challenges such as high costs and stringent regulatory environments that can impact the speed of product approvals. The competitive landscape is characterized by a few dominant players who are constantly innovating to maintain their market positions. Regional dynamics play a crucial role, with North America maintaining a leading stance due to advanced healthcare infrastructure, while emerging markets in Asia are witnessing rapid adoption fueled by improving healthcare systems and rising disposable incomes. These regional variations highlight the importance of tailored strategies to address specific market needs and regulatory requirements.

Key Insights
- The integration of advanced AI technologies into breast ultrasound systems is transforming diagnostic capabilities, enhancing image clarity and reducing interpretation time, which is a significant trend shaping the market.
- Major players are increasingly focusing on strategic partnerships and acquisitions to broaden their product portfolios and expand their geographical reach, reflecting a highly competitive landscape.
- Regulatory standards are becoming more stringent, necessitating continuous innovation and compliance to ensure product approvals, which poses a challenge for new market entrants.
- North America remains a dominant market due to robust healthcare infrastructure and high awareness, while Asia-Pacific is gaining momentum with increasing investments in healthcare advancements.
- Price sensitivity in emerging markets presents a challenge, prompting manufacturers to develop cost-effective solutions without compromising on quality or performance.
- Ongoing research and development efforts are focused on enhancing system mobility and user-friendliness, addressing the need for efficient and patient-friendly diagnostic processes.
- Increased government initiatives aimed at improving cancer diagnostics and treatment are driving demand, particularly in regions with historically lower access to advanced healthcare technologies.
- Consumer awareness and education campaigns are crucial in boosting market demand, as they highlight the importance of early detection and regular screenings.
- Environmental sustainability trends are influencing product development, with manufacturers exploring eco-friendly materials and energy-efficient systems to align with global standards.
- The shift towards outpatient settings and ambulatory care centers is creating new opportunities for portable and user-friendly ultrasound systems, driving market growth.
